Transaction e508ca61b0e4248cf2d30f551332ea0b774dbbf5cc9aff69f10ea1148bdc20b2
1 Input
1 Output
-
e508ca61b0e4248cf2d30f551332ea0b774dbbf5cc9aff69f10ea1148bdc20b2:0
- value
- 561321118
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4100d87e5c26811857ff8b16100091bc5c5eaf23 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16vhwED4FZSEhjzwANp88Wyy6BuzZ1rAmw